The IRS decided to allow religious leaders to endorse political candidates from the pulpit. One expert said Texas — with more than 200 megachurches — will be the epicenter for pastors and congregations to test out their new influence.

Former Anti-Abortion Leader Alleges Another Supreme Court Breach

Years before the leaked draft opinion overturning Roe v. Wade, a landmark contraception ruling was disclosed, according to a minister who led a secretive effort to influence justices.
